They are using a REXX that generates 

HRECALL (file1 file2 file3 file4 etc...) NOWAIT

Or some will submit a TSO Batch job with individual HRECALL file1 NOWAIT
commands.


I am not happy with this process and am I working to create a better REXX
for them to use for this.  But for now, we have requested that if they have
over 1000 recalls to be done, to let my group work on them.

The rewrite is that the command to HSM to alter priority for that userid
will also be done at the end of the HRECALL requests.  That way I can at
least place them at the bottom of the priority and let other HSM RECALLS
happen as they come into the queue.

> > If you have CRQ(Common Recall Queue) set up, then HSM will "look ahead"
> and recall
> > all files that are on the same tape. Also, with CRQ, you can limit
> > which
> LPARS will
> > perform recalls and limit them in that manner and all recalls will be
> routed to that
> > LPAR. Otherwise, the recalls happen one at a time in a FIFO manner.

> > >When it HSM finishes a recall, it checks the que in order for any
> > >recall on the same tape.  When it reaches the end of the que, it
> > >unmounts the tape, and starts recalling the first waiting dataset on
> > >the que.  Haven't done as massive a quantity as 10,000 though.
> > >
> > >No sorting of any kind, just checking the que DSN against the list on
> > >the mounted tape.
